Job Summary

This position is a direct report to the Group Product Manager. Position is responsible for providing technical leadership, system administration and maintenance functions for a diverse population of plant process Real-time computing systems at PSEG Nuclear. This system support includes the following areas: Cisco Networks, Access/SQL databases, Windows/Linux Servers, Nuclear Real-time applications and Nuclear Cyber Security.

Job Responsibilities

•    Act as a support engineer for Nuclear Real-time systems and their subsystems utilizing an understanding of available technology, tools, existing designs and regulatory requirements (e.g., NEI 08-09 R6) security controls, policies and procedures
•    Collect, consolidate and analyze business and technical requirements from key constituents. Recommend appropriate technological designs and solutions that comply with regulatory requirements and IT architectural and PSEG's business strategies, and provide the most efficient and cost effective solution
•    Support the delivery of the network solutions, including requirements analysis, internal proposal preparation, RFP development, vendor statement of work evaluation, tool selection, and implementation planning.
•    Working and communicating with a wide range of people – peers, vendors, staff members, broader functional and business leadership, and others. Consistently demonstrate professional, positive, and approachable attitude, demeanor and discretion.
•    Manages product life-cycle based events – upgrades, patching etc.
•    Ensures quality through the use of company-approved methodologies

 

Job Specific Qualifications

   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, Engineering, Math or a related field or relevant experience

•    2 or more years of relevant experience within the IT field or related industry with reliance on technical expertise. Without a bachelor’s degree, must have at least 6 years of relevant experience within IT field or related industry with reliance on technical expertise.

•    Ability to pass and maintain Nuclear Engineering Support Population (ESP) within first year of employment.
•    Ability to pass and maintain Nuclear Digital qualification.
•    Experience with and able to support some or all of the following:
      o    Microsoft Windows Server operating system
      o    UNIX operating system
      o    VMS operating System
      o    CISCO Network configurations e.g.     LAN/VLAN/WAN/MAN/WiFi/IPsec VPN tunnels/ WINS/DNS/DHCP/VIPs/QoS/MPLS/RIP/EIGRP/OSPF/BGP/HSRP/GLBP.
      o    Dell Server technologies and products
      o    Desktop hardware and software technologies
      o    MS Access and SQL database general support
      o    IT Cyber Security – SIEM/IDS support
      o    VMware

Desired: 
•    Good problem solving and root cause analysis skills
•    Position is a member of the PSEG Nuclear Critical Group and candidate must: 
•    Be available for call-out and overtime support to perform system maintenance when needed after normal business hours
•    Fulfill and maintain PSEG Nuclear requirements for holding a badge for unescorted access by successfully completing fitness-for-duty, OSHA, general employee, Rad Worker and other required training
•    Support PSEG Nuclear Emergency Preparedness program drills and events
